Yet, we must gently remind you, and all who read this, that while we stand in the authority of Christ, our resistance to the enemy must always be coupled with humility and wisdom. The Word also warns, "Be sober and self-controlled. Be watchful. Your adversary, the devil, walks around like a roaring lion, seeking whom he may devour" (1 Peter 5:8 WEB). Even as we resist, we must guard our hearts against pride or anger, for the enemy seeks to provoke us into sin. "A gentle answer turns away wrath, but a harsh word stirs up anger" (Proverbs 15:1 WEB). Let your resistance be marked by the fruit of the Spirit, love, patience, and self-control, so that the devil finds no foothold in your life.
We also lift up the importance of prayerful discernment in verbal confrontations. While it is right to stand on God’s Word, we must ensure that our words align with His heart. "Let your speech always be with grace, seasoned with salt, that you may know how you ought to answer each one" (Colossians 4:6 WEB). The Lord may call us to speak truth in love, but He also calls us to hold our peace when silence is the greater weapon. Trust that the Holy Spirit will guide you in when to speak and when to remain still, for "the Lord will fight for you, and you shall hold your peace" (Exodus 14:14 WEB).
